## Formula sandbox tuning

User-supplied formulas in Gridmoor execute inside a restricted interpreter with hard ceilings on time, memory, and call depth. Reviewers should confirm any change to these ceilings is justified in the PR description, since raising them widens the abuse surface. Defaults were chosen from production traces. The current limits are as follows.

limits module of tafog-fawip:
WEIGHTS = {
    "julix": 57,
    "lamys": 992,
    "kasvan": 209,
    "quenok": 750,
    "alddor": 259,
    "oliath": 1009,
    "wenix": 815,
}

**Ticket: Contrast audit blocked — expired creds**

Hey! Welcome aboard. The Huescan contrast checker stopped pulling pages from our staging site because its old credentials expired last Friday. We rotated everything this morning, so the audit runs should work again once you reconfigure your local scanner. Plug in the fresh key below and re-run the homepage batch.

API key for yahig-tadup: kto7_ubizbYm

## Step 4: Sandbox your formulas

If your plugin lets users type custom formulas into Gridleaf, don't run them raw — wrap them in the Hexwell sandbox runtime so a rogue expression can't touch the host filesystem or network. Set `sandbox: strict` in your manifest, then rebuild. Before Gridleaf will load the sandboxed bundle, it has to be signed. Use the key below to sign your build.

signing key of fajop-tahop = bky9_qdL6xeDv7

Re: Q2 Cash-Flow Forecast, Derrowfield Retail Group

The Q2 forecast anticipates net inflows of 2.8m across all branches, with the strongest contribution expected from the Ellsmere site following its refit. Seasonal stock purchasing will compress free cash in April; please defer non-essential capital requests until May. Branch-level targets and weekly reporting templates are attached, and variances above 5% must be escalated promptly. The planning assumptions behind this forecast are explained in the confidential note below.

board note of baweg-bawig: Project Tamath slips by six weeks because of the audit delay.